Description
These Crispy Roasted Sweet Potatoes are perfectly seasoned and oven-roasted to golden perfection. With a blend of smoked paprika, chipotle chili powder, garlic, and onion powder, they offer a smoky, slightly spicy flavor that enhances the natural sweetness of the potatoes. Easy to prepare and ideal as a side dish or snack, these sweet potatoes are crispy on the outside and tender inside.
Ingredients
Scale
Sweet Potatoes
- 1½ pounds sweet potatoes (peeled or unpeeled, diced into ¾-inch cubes)
Seasoning & Oil
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- ½ teaspoon smoked paprika
- ½ teaspoon chipotle chili powder
- ½ teaspoon garlic powder
- ½ teaspoon onion powder
- ½ teaspoon kosher salt
Instructions
- Preheat Oven: Preheat the oven to 425°F (220°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or lightly grease it to prevent sticking.
- Prepare Potatoes: Wash and dice the sweet potatoes into even-sized ¾-inch cubes. Pat them dry thoroughly with paper towels to ensure they roast up crispy.
- Season: In a large bowl, toss the diced sweet potatoes with olive oil, smoked paprika, chipotle chili powder, garlic powder, onion powder, and kosher salt until they are evenly coated with the seasoning mixture.
- Roast: Spread the seasoned sweet potatoes in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et, avoiding overcrowding. Roast them in the preheated oven for 25 to 30 minutes, flipping them halfway through the baking time to ensure even crisping. Roast until the edges are crispy and golden brown.
- Serve: Remove the roasted sweet potatoes from the oven and serve hot. For added brightness and flavor, optionally sprinkle with fresh herbs or a squeeze of lime juice before serving.
Notes
- For maximum crispiness, ensure the sweet potato cubes are evenly sized and well patted dry before seasoning.
- Do not overcrowd the baking sheet; roasting in a single layer helps achieve a crisp texture.
- Adjust the smoked paprika and chipotle chili powder amounts for more or less spiciness according to preference.
- Fresh herbs like cilantro or parsley can enhance the flavor if sprinkled on top after roasting.
- These can be reheated in the oven at 400°F for 5-7 minutes to regain crispiness.
